The quote is accurately attributed to Tony Blair and aligns with his leadership rhetoric during his tenure as UK Prime Minister. It reflects his vision for Britain as a proactive and influential nation. No evidence suggests the statement is fabricated or misattributed.
Achtergrond
Tony Blair became UK Prime Minister in May 1997, and his speeches often emphasized themes of bold leadership and national ambition. The Labour Party Conference was a key platform for such messaging.
Samenvatting verdict
Anthony Charles Lynton Blair did make this statement at the Labour Party Conference in 1997.
